Title American theatre book of monologues for women / edited by Stephanie Coen.

Publication Info. New York : Theatre Communications Group, 2003.

Copies

Location Call No. Status
 Glastonbury, Welles-Turner Memorial Library - Adult Department  808.824 AMERICAN    Check Shelf
 West Hartford, Noah Webster Library - Non Fiction  808.8245 AMERICAN    Check Shelf
Edition First edition.
Description xxiii, 145 pages ; 22 cm
Note Audition monologues selected from plays first published in American theatre magazine since 1985.
Bibliography Includes bibliographical references.
